Grant: 24-035C
Project Title: Necropsy Room Renovations for Clearwater Marine Aquarium
Project Manager: Kerry McNally
Organization: Clearwater Marine Aquarium (Non-Profit Organization)
Grant Amount: $25,915.00
Completion Date: 2025-05-28
Summary: Necropsies are important to understand the anatomy, health, and disease of sea turtles. Clearwater Marine Aquarium (CMA) has performed 231 necropsies on sea turtles since 2018. The status of equipment such as the necropsy table and doors is in poor condition. Overall, the current necropsy room has limitations that require improvement. The project will allow CMA to purchase a necropsy table to help improve the standards, efficiency, and safety of necropsies conducted on sea turtles at CMA.Results: The newly installed table is C-shaped and measures 48" x 84", providing more surface area compared to our previous table (36" x 84"). Additionally, the upgraded table features a hydraulic lift system that can lower the surface to 15" and raise it up to 48" - a capability that was not available with our former setup. This hydraulic function has greatly improved the safety and ergonomics for our animal health teams, especially when working with large adult sea turtles. The table was utilized within 10 days of delivery for an adult sea turtle necropsy. From the time of delivery to the date of this report, CMA has performed necropsies on 1 adult, 2 subadults, and 22 juvenile turtles on this table. This marks a notable increase of 20 more necropsies during the same timeframe in 2024. The improved size and functionality of the table have allowed for more efficient procedures. On seven separate occasions, multiple necropsies were performed simultaneously, with at least two turtles being examined at once. This capability significantly enhances our capacity during periods of high stranding events.
